online reservation necessary if you're not in the campground before 4.30 pm. called to make a reservation. got an email saying that our license plate number was missing on the reservation. email had a link to fill it in but software didn't work. arrived at 5 pm. everywhere warnings that entering without registration of license plate was gonna be punished with fines. tried to go to visitor centre but that was of course closed. campsite host was not to be found... we drove in anyhow and could not find our campspot. site 36 (our reserved spot) was taken. little did we know (because nobody told us and de campmap didn't show) that there is a separate numbering for tent camping, our spot t36 referred to a totally different part of the campsite for tent camping (again, nobody told us at the moment of the reservation and the numbers are not on the camp map). More important, we drive a camper van with trailer, total 31 feet (we mentioned this during reservation) that hardly fitted the t36 tent campspot. luckely there were hardly any campers and we managed to get in the tent campspot. what more? we wanted a campspot on the lake but there is no path to the lake. showers are dirty and have only cold water... we gonna stay one night... a place to avoid...

100% disabled veterans get 50% off of "base rate" not actually rate of campsite chosen. Make sure you verify costs first before coming here so you know. Example; my site was regularly 35, and it cost me 27 after discount.
